An account in Fairhope, Alabama 36532 United States of America

drone/UFO like sound. it sounded like it was right over my house. it was incredibly loud and echoey and definitely metal/machine like. it’s hard to describe. my mom was awake and did not hear it, but my dogs went ballistic over it. it lasted about 4-5 seconds, but did not repeat. i have never heard the noise before and i have severe anxiety so i know what everything sounds like. but this noise was bone chilling. my stomach sank like something horrible was about to happen. i looked all around outside, and nothing was there. no

What they reported

First noticed: 2020

Loudest: During the night

Where: Indoors

Symptoms: Insomnia, Sense of vibration, Anxiety

Changes with weather: no
